Essential Utilities Inc. (NYSE: WTRG) today announced upgraded ESG ratings by three prominent rating agencies: ISS QualityScore, MSCI and Sustainalytics. These agencies, among many others, utilize varying methodologies to score companies on their commitment to corporate social responsibility. Aqua America Inc. (NYSE: WTR) received the Forum of Executive Women’s Advancing Women Company Award on Nov. 14. The award recognizes companies that go above and beyond to create cultures where women can thrive, succeed and have a voice.Aqua America Chief Administrative Officer Susan Haindl accepted the award on behalf of the company. “Aqua values the incredible women who work here, and we continue to create opportunities for women to grow and succeed throughout the company. Aqua America Inc. (NYSE: WTR) was celebrated as a Champion of Board Diversity by the Forum of Executive Women at its leadership breakfast today. The recognition honored companies with a board of directors comprising at least 30 percent women.
